Which way is the market leaning in Outremont?
Outremont is discreet elegance: tree-lined avenues, Bernard and Laurier, beautiful homes, and a well-anchored Francophone tradition. The neighborhood is also undergoing a major transformation with the Université de Montréal’s MIL campus, which brings Outremont and Parc-Extension closer together and redraws its northern border. It is an area of established families and professionals, where people rarely buy and even more rarely sell. The scarcity of supply supports the market better than elsewhere. Neighbourhood profile
Character of the area
Heritage single-family homes, prestigious plexes, and character condos. Rare supply; sustained value. The MIL campus sector to the east is bringing new developments.
Transportation
Outremont, Édouard-Montpetit (REM connection), and Acadie metro stations.
Shops & services
Bernard and Laurier avenues: restaurants, boutiques, Outremont Theatre.
Schools & parks
UdeM’s MIL Campus on the border; renowned schools; Outremont, Beaubien, and Pratt parks.
